support/kconfig: upgrade to 3.9-rc2
Our kconfig code is updated to the version of kernel 3.9-rc2. No major
issues during the migration, except:
* Some conflicts when applying 03-change-config-option-prefix.patch
due to upstream kernel changes.
* The need of adding a new patch, 15-fix-qconf-moc-rule.patch, to fix
the make rule that generates the moc file for the Qt-based
interface.
